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Radware Ltd Chief Operating Officer Gabriel Malka reported her initial ownership of 64,533 Ordinary Shares of the company in a Form 3 filing. These holdings are reported as directly owned.

The position includes multiple grants of restricted share units (RSUs) that convert into Ordinary Shares as they vest over time. The RSUs cover 500 shares granted on May 2, 2022 that vest on May 2, 2026; 6,500 shares granted on August 17, 2022 that vest on August 17, 2026; and 6,222 shares granted on October 31, 2023, with 3,111 vesting on each of October 31, 2026 and October 31, 2027. Additional RSUs include 26,700 shares granted on October 30, 2024 with tranches vesting from October 30, 2026 through October 30, 2028; 12,000 shares granted on October 28, 2025 vesting between October 28, 2027 and October 28, 2029; and 3,000 shares granted on February 10, 2026 vesting between February 10, 2028 and February 10, 2030.

Explanation of Responses:
1. Includes 500 Ordinary Shares that are represented by restricted share units ("RSUs") that were granted on May 2, 2022 and vest on May 2, 2026. Each RSU represents a contingent right to receive one Ordinary Share of the Issuer upon settlement.
2. Includes 6,500 Ordinary Shares that are represented by RSUs that were granted on August 17, 2022 and vest on August 17, 2026.
3. Includes 6,222 Ordinary Shares that are represented by RSUs that were granted on October 31, 2023, of which 3,111 vest on each of October 31, 2026 and October 31, 2027.
4. Includes 26,700 Ordinary Shares that are represented by RSUs that were granted on October 30, 2024, of which 13,350 vest on October 30, 2026 and 6,675 vest on each of October 30, 2027 and October 30, 2028.
5. Includes 12,000 Ordinary Shares that are represented by RSUs that were granted on October 28, 2025, of which 6,000 vest on October 28, 2027 and 3,000 vest on each of October 28, 2028 and October 28, 2029.
6. Includes 3,000 Ordinary Shares that are represented by RSUs that were granted on February 10, 2026, of which 1,500 vest on February 10, 2028 and 750 vest on each of February 10, 2029 and February 10, 2030.
